Outline of Final Research Achievements

The curved aromatic compounds have been expected to show the unique physical properties derived from their π-conjugated systems. In this study, the synthesis of belt-like polycyclic aromatic system was studied by performing a thermal self-cycloaddition of the isobenzofuran containing an electron-acceptor moiety. Two approaches for the donor-acceptor molecules were developed by utilizing either bisaryne or bisisobenzofuran as the reactive platforms, which enabled the construction of belt-like polycyclic molecules.
